Alyse Jessup

Written by Alyse Jessup

Published: 23 Mar 2025

38-facts-about-batch-processing
Source: Blog.botcity.dev

Batch processing is a method of running high-volume, repetitive data jobs efficiently. But why is it so important? Batch processing allows for the automation of tasks, reducing the need for manual intervention. This means that large amounts of data can be processed quickly and accurately, saving both time and resources. Imagine a factory assembly line, but for data. It’s used in various industries, from banking to healthcare, ensuring that operations run smoothly. Batch processing can handle tasks like payroll, billing, and data analysis, making it a backbone for many business operations. Curious to know more? Let's dive into 38 intriguing facts about batch processing that will shed light on its significance and versatility.

Table of Contents

What is Batch Processing?

Batch processing is a method where data or tasks are collected and processed in groups or "batches" at a scheduled time. This technique is widely used in various industries for its efficiency and cost-effectiveness.

  1. 01Batch processing originated in the early days of computing when computers were large and expensive. Operators would collect jobs and run them all at once to maximize machine usage.
  2. 02Mainframes were the first computers to use batch processing extensively. They could handle large volumes of data and complex calculations, making them ideal for this method.
  3. 03Batch jobs are often scheduled to run during off-peak hours to minimize the impact on system performance and availability.
  4. 04Financial institutions use batch processing for tasks like payroll, billing, and end-of-day transactions. This ensures accuracy and efficiency.
  5. 05Batch processing is also common in manufacturing, where it helps streamline production lines and manage inventory.

Advantages of Batch Processing

Batch processing offers several benefits that make it a preferred choice for many organizations.

  1. 06Efficiency is a key advantage. By processing data in batches, systems can handle large volumes of work without constant human intervention.
  2. 07Cost savings are significant. Batch processing reduces the need for continuous monitoring and allows for better resource allocation.
  3. 08Error reduction is another benefit. Automated batch jobs minimize the risk of human error, ensuring more accurate results.
  4. 09Scalability is enhanced. Batch processing systems can easily be scaled up to handle larger volumes of data as needed.
  5. 10Resource optimization is achieved by scheduling batch jobs during off-peak hours, making better use of system resources.

Disadvantages of Batch Processing

Despite its advantages, batch processing has some drawbacks that need consideration.

  1. 11Latency is a common issue. Since tasks are processed in batches, there can be delays in getting results.
  2. 12Complexity in setup and maintenance can be challenging. Configuring batch jobs requires careful planning and expertise.
  3. 13Lack of real-time processing means that batch processing is not suitable for tasks requiring immediate results.
  4. 14Error handling can be difficult. If an error occurs in a batch job, it may affect the entire batch, complicating troubleshooting.
  5. 15Resource contention may arise if batch jobs are not scheduled properly, leading to performance issues.

Real-World Applications of Batch Processing

Batch processing is used in various industries for different purposes.

  1. 16Banking relies heavily on batch processing for tasks like clearing checks, updating account balances, and generating statements.
  2. 17Retail uses batch processing for inventory management, order processing, and sales reporting.
  3. 18Healthcare benefits from batch processing in areas like patient record updates, billing, and reporting.
  4. 19Telecommunications companies use batch processing for billing, customer data management, and network maintenance.
  5. 20Government agencies employ batch processing for tasks like tax processing, social security updates, and census data analysis.

Batch Processing in Modern Computing

With advancements in technology, batch processing has evolved to meet new demands.

  1. 21Cloud computing has revolutionized batch processing by offering scalable and flexible resources. Organizations can now run batch jobs on-demand without investing in expensive hardware.
  2. 22Big data analytics often rely on batch processing to handle vast amounts of data efficiently. Tools like Hadoop and Spark are designed for this purpose.
  3. 23Automation has enhanced batch processing, allowing for more complex workflows and reducing the need for manual intervention.
  4. 24Integration with real-time systems is now possible, enabling hybrid approaches that combine batch and real-time processing.
  5. 25Security in batch processing has improved with encryption and access controls, ensuring data integrity and confidentiality.

Future of Batch Processing

The future of batch processing looks promising with ongoing innovations and improvements.

  1. 26Artificial intelligence and machine learning are expected to play a significant role in optimizing batch processing workflows.
  2. 27Edge computing may bring batch processing closer to data sources, reducing latency and improving efficiency.
  3. 28Serverless computing offers a new paradigm where batch jobs can run without the need for dedicated servers, further reducing costs.
  4. 29Blockchain technology could enhance batch processing by providing secure and transparent transaction records.
  5. 30Quantum computing holds the potential to revolutionize batch processing with unprecedented processing power.

Fun Facts about Batch Processing

Here are some interesting tidbits about batch processing that you might not know.

  1. 31NASA uses batch processing for space mission simulations and data analysis.
  2. 32Hollywood relies on batch processing for rendering special effects in movies.
  3. 33Video game development often involves batch processing for compiling code and assets.
  4. 34Weather forecasting models use batch processing to analyze vast amounts of meteorological data.
  5. 35Social media platforms employ batch processing for tasks like data mining and user behavior analysis.
  6. 36E-commerce giants use batch processing to manage massive databases of products, orders, and customer information.
  7. 37Energy companies rely on batch processing for grid management and consumption analysis.
  8. 38Educational institutions use batch processing for student record management, scheduling, and reporting.

Final Thoughts on Batch Processing

Batch processing is a game-changer for handling large volumes of data efficiently. It automates repetitive tasks, saving both time and resources. This method is especially useful in industries like finance, healthcare, and manufacturing where data accuracy and speed are crucial. By processing data in batches, companies can ensure consistency and reduce the risk of errors. It's also cost-effective, as it allows for better resource management.

Understanding the ins and outs of batch processing can give businesses a competitive edge. It streamlines operations, enhances productivity, and ultimately leads to better decision-making. Whether you're a tech enthusiast or a business professional, knowing about batch processing can open up new opportunities for innovation and efficiency. So, next time you encounter a massive data task, remember that batch processing might just be the solution you need.

Was this page helpful?

Our commitment to delivering trustworthy and engaging content is at the heart of what we do. Each fact on our site is contributed by real users like you, bringing a wealth of diverse insights and information. To ensure the highest standards of accuracy and reliability, our dedicated editors meticulously review each submission. This process guarantees that the facts we share are not only fascinating but also credible. Trust in our commitment to quality and authenticity as you explore and learn with us.